为了账号安全,请及时绑定邮箱和手机立即绑定

你能为Python的语法添加新的语句吗?

你能为Python的语法添加新的语句吗?

尚方宝剑之说 2019-08-06 15:06:16
你能为Python的语法添加新的语句吗?你可以添加新的语句(例如print,raise,with)Python的语法?说,允许..mystatement "Something"要么,new_if True:     print "example"如果你应该,而不是如果它是可能的(没有修改python解释器代码)
查看完整描述

3 回答

?
呼唤远方

TA贡献1856条经验 获得超11个赞

是的,在某种程度上它是可能的。有一个模块在那里,使用sys.settrace()实施gotocomefrom“关键词”:

from goto import goto, labelfor i in range(1, 10):
  for j in range(1, 20):
    print i, j    if j == 3:
      goto .end # breaking out from nested looplabel .endprint "Finished"


查看完整回答
反对 回复 2019-08-06
  • 3 回答
  • 0 关注
  • 587 浏览
慕课专栏
更多

添加回答

举报

0/150
提交
取消
意见反馈 帮助中心 APP下载
官方微信